  1. Cool computational method for separating γδ #Tcells by #rna #sequencing
    Rather than relying on paired #TCRseq or #CITEseq, they calculate module scores of TCR constant and variable region gene expression

  4. 'They identified the 11 most frequently occurring CD4TCRs in mice bearing an autochthonous tumor line. Three TCRs showed evidence of convergent evolution, because T cell clonotypes had different nucleotide sequences but identical TCR α and β chains.'

  10. Impressive new work by Moravec et al. in Nature Biotechnology, sadly not open source. "... a #HighThroughput personalized #TCR discovery pipeline ..." with which they "...identified dozens of CD4+ and CD8+ T-cell-derived TCRs with potent tumor reactivity, including TCRs that recognized patient-specific #neoantigens."

  15. Pension Benefit Information has reported a #MOVEit-related breach in relation to an unspecified client which affected >300k people.

    #PBI's clients include orgs which have already disclosed being impacted: #CapPERS, #CalSTRS, #TIAA and #TCRS.

    Stats -

    Organizations impacted: 280
    Individuals impacted: 18,139,588
